java如何匹配sql数据

java如何匹配sql数据

作者:Elara发布时间:2026-02-09阅读时长:0 分钟阅读次数:2

用户关注问题

Q
如何使用Java连接数据库以读取SQL数据?

我想用Java程序从数据库中获取数据,应该如何建立连接以及执行查询操作?

A

使用JDBC连接数据库并执行SQL查询

Java通常通过JDBC(Java Database Connectivity)接口连接数据库。需要导入相应的数据库驱动,建立数据库连接,创建Statement或PreparedStatement对象,然后执行SQL查询语句,最后处理结果集(ResultSet)。操作完成后应关闭连接和相关资源。

Q
如何在Java代码中根据条件匹配SQL数据?

如果想根据特定条件查询数据库中的数据,Java应该如何编写相应代码?

A

使用预编译的PreparedStatement进行条件匹配

为了实现条件匹配,可使用PreparedStatement对象,通过设置参数替代SQL语句中的占位符。这样不仅提升查询效率,也避免SQL注入风险。示例代码中使用setString、setInt等方法绑定参数,然后执行查询。

Q
Java处理SQL查询结果数据有什么建议?

从数据库查询到的数据,Java程序中一般如何处理和使用这些结果?

A

遍历ResultSet并提取数据

从SQL查询获得的数据以ResultSet形式返回,可以逐行遍历ResultSet,调用getString、getInt等方法提取每列数据。建议将数据封装成自定义对象便于后续操作。完成后务必关闭ResultSet、Statement和Connection,防止资源泄露。